Tennis: bee invasion interrupts match between Alcaraz and Zverev at Indian Wells. Hundreds of bees invade the court at the Masters 1000 tournament.

The bees, visibly present in their hundreds, have notably settled around the “spidercam” used on the center court of the North American tournament. Both players had just started the game, only two games had been played (1-1) in less than ten minutes. At the time of writing, the match had not yet been able to resume.
